KONE Elevator India has expanded its Bengaluru Branch and South Regional Office in Hebbal, reinforcing its focus on Karnataka as demand for smart vertical mobility solutions rises alongside the state’s booming residential, commercial and Global Capability Centre (GCC) developments.
The expanded facility will serve as KONE’s operational hub for Karnataka while also functioning as the South Regional Office, overseeing sales, installation, service and modernization operations across the state and providing leadership for the company’s business in South India.
The move comes as Karnataka, led by Bengaluru, continues to attract investments in information technology, manufacturing, healthcare and mixed-use developments, creating sustained demand for elevators, escalators and digitally connected building mobility solutions.
Experience centre for customers
Apart from supporting operations across Bengaluru and cities such as Mysuru, Mandya, Kolar, Tumakuru and Chamarajanagar, the new office will house an experience centre showcasing KONE’s latest elevator technologies, digital solutions and smart People Flow® innovations.
The expanded presence is expected to improve customer response times, strengthen lifecycle maintenance services and enable closer collaboration with developers and enterprises executing large-scale projects across the region.
Strong project portfolio
KONE has built a significant portfolio in Karnataka, supplying mobility solutions for a wide range of residential, commercial, healthcare and technology park developments.
Its customers in the state include ITC Green Centre, IKEA,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E), ITPL, Embassy Group, Titanium Tech Park, Sattva Group, Karle Group, Sobha Group, Prestige Group, Shriram Properties, GE HealthCare, Carl Zeiss, Wistron and several other leading developers and enterprises.

Chennai anchors India operations
KONE has been operating in India since 1984 and is headquartered in Chennai. The company serves customers through more than 50 branches across the country and employs over 5,500 people.
Its manufacturing facility at Sriperumbudur near Chennai supplies elevators to India as well as neighbouring markets including Bangladesh, Bhutan, Nepal and Sri Lanka. KONE also operates training centres in Chennai, Gurugram and Pune, while its global technology and engineering centres in Chennai and Pune support research and development for future mobility solutions.
